Prag News is a 24x7 Assamese news channel. The channel has many times shared false claims and fake news through their platform.[1] It is one of the oldest local news channels of Assam based in Guwahati.[2][better source needed]

Quick Facts Country, Broadcast area ...

It was launched on 4 March 2001 as a cable-based television channel.[3] The channel covers local, national and international news and various other programs.

As per a Newslaundry report, Once, the channel falsely reported that Bandana Kalita, an accused in a murder case, had demanded pork while in custody. The news channel also alleged that she had mutilated the victims' bodies and stored them in a refrigerator.[1]

However, at a press conference, Guwahati Police Commissioner Diganta Bora clarified, "In our investigation, we have not found anything about any fridge". When questioned by reporters about the accused's alleged demand for chicken, he dismissed it with a laugh, stating, "You also reported about a fridge… but we never mentioned it".[1]

It has also become embroiled in controversy following the resignation of a pregnant employee. Ranjita Rabha, a reporter, resigned on 5 May, allegedly under pressure from the management due to her pregnancy.[4]

As claimed by Rabha, she transitioned to desk duties in late January, which reportedly didn't sit well with her managers, who preferred "agile people." In her social media post on 19 May, She was five months pregnant when Rabha accused the TV channel of forcing her to resign and denying her request for unpaid maternity leave. Her post triggered backlash, with Assam journalists and the Indian Journalists Union condemning the channel's actions. The IJU also expressed serious concern over her dismissal.[4]
